  • I was raised Mormon and lived in Utah until I was 20 years old. Trust me, the family featured on Sister Wives is one of the most normal polygamist families I have ever seen.  The ones everyone sees on the news from the "ranch" or the "compound" are much more weird/extremist and strict in their practices. Kody and his family are actually pretty normal as far as polygamist families go in urban Utah cities (they are everywhere, just not usually not "out" publicly).

    It's a really long story, but basically ALL Mormons were polygamists when Mormonism first began. It was a practice that was put into place both for religious and practical reasons. Then, when Utah wanted to become a state in the Union, the Mormon leaders were told they'd have to give up polygamy first. So that's when the Mormons split into 2 groups: what are now called "mainstream Mormons" who do not practice polygamy, and "fundamentalist" Mormons, or polygamists (they refused to give up the practice of polygamy just to appease political pressure). 

    Anyway, without going into a big history lesson, I just wanted to say while I myself couldn't do the polygamist thing (I couldn't even do the Mormon thing anymore!), I do know many people, even family members, on both sides of the fence and they are actually very normal, loving, religious people who are just living their beliefs. Just another instance where I try to extend the same acceptance and understanding I'd ask for those who do not agree with my lifestyle. We all just gotta get along :)
